How safe is Bampton?
Bampton has an average crime rate for a North West village, with around 25 recorded crimes per 1,000 people a year. This is 67% below the national average, and 62% below the Cumbria average. The comparison is stabilised for a small population. Most incidents are concentrated around a single location.
What are the demographics of Bampton?
The majority of residents in Bampton identify as White (British) (94%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(96%). The most common religion is Christian (51%).
